The third edition of “Regina Ribelle – Vernaccia di San Gimignano Wine Fest” was a big success
From 15 to 18 May, San Gimignano hosted the third edition of “Regina Ribelle – Vernaccia di San Gimignano Wine Fest”, an event capable of combining culture, food & wine, and entertainment, and involving the entire territory. Four days brimming with events for the public and the trade press, including tastings, masterclasses, food & wine pairing workshops, and plenty of entertainment.
Taking stock: growing numbers and participation
The presence of about 1600 wine lovers in the Wine Fest days open to the public (17 and 18 May) accounted for over 10,000 tastings of Vernaccia di San Gimignano, the exquisite Tuscan white wine. The event saw the participation of 35 local wineries, with a steadily increasing turnout compared to previous editions.
The presence of the Food & Wine press was also quite significant: over 80 journalists from Italy, Europe, the United States and Canada took part in the Press Days on 15 and 16 May. The guided San Gimignano Doc tasting led by Marco Sabellico was sold out and offered a golden opportunity to enhance the understanding of the terroir.

The Gala Dinner: an unforgettable experience
The highlight of the Press Days was the gala dinner, held for the first time in San Gimignano’s spectacular Piazza del Duomo. Thanks to the impeccable organisation of Chef Gaetano Trovato (two Michelin stars, Arnolfo), the evening offered an exclusive gastronomic experience in a dream location to 150 guests, including the press, authorities and producers.
Awards and culture: an event that celebrates excellence
This third edition also hosted the 2025 Best AIS Sommelier in Tuscany Award, emphasising the importance of the event as a meeting point for sector professionals. Luca Marchiani triumphed as the 2025 award winner. Moments of art and culture added lustre to the festival, with an exclusive visit to Galleria Continua and the presentation of Andrea Roggi’s sculpture dedicated to Vernaccia.
